Coulthard: 'Unacceptable' mistakes a chink in Leclerc's armour

David Coulthard says Charles Leclerc is Ferrari's strongest asset, but the Monegasque's errors are also an unacceptable "chink in his armour". In Miami last time out, Leclerc crashed twice over the weekend at the same corner, his second error occurring in qualifying and potentially costing him pole position or at the very minimum a spot on the front row of the race. The Ferrari charger's Australian Grand Prix was also a wash-out due to a mistake and a contact on the opening lap of the race in Melbourne.
